About us
M&T Bank is a multi-state community-focused bank serving New York, Maryland, New Jersey, Pennsylvania, Delaware, Connecticut, Virginia, West Virginia and Washington, D.C. Founded in 1856, the company provides banking, investment, insurance and mortgage financial services to more than 3.6 million consumer, business and government clients. National Small Business Week is one of our favorite times of the year. During this special week (and the other 51!), we can't help but be inspired by the stories of entrepreneurs like Donald Moyer and Sam Rosado, Co-Owners of Rhino Linings of Delaware. Rhino Linings of Delaware has been a part of Donald's life since its inception in June 1997. As a teen, he started with small shop tasks and eventually was given the opportunity to grow the Accessories side of the business. After graduating from college, he began utilizing his electrical skills to expand the scope of the business. Over the last 12 years, he has expanded to fleet vehicle upfitting and has never been happier. Sam started in 2009 as a Counter Sales associate and was quickly promoted. He has worked in customer service his whole life and loves what he does, "People say when you love what you do, you'll never work a day in your life. It took me a while to grasp that, but I love this job: the people and the spontaneity of every day. No two days are the same. Helping customers with custom builds and watching their vision come together is what it's all about. I am super excited about this next chapter as a small business owner. So grateful for this opportunity."
